The Rise of Indian Pharma: Challenges and Opportunities
The nation's pharmaceutical market has witnessed a significant rise, becoming a global leader . However , this progress isn't free from challenges. Growing raw material expenses, more rigorous regulatory standards from agencies like the USFDA, and intense competition from alternative drug producers pose considerable hurdles. Even with these obstacles , the environment offers ample opportunities – including entering emerging regions, focusing on novel therapeutic delivery techniques, and utilizing biotechnology and biosimilar development potential .
